Jeep owners take pride in their vehicles, and one way to show that is by using tire covers. Tire covers come in a variety of materials, sizes, and designs. But what should you look for when buying a tire cover for your Jeep? Here is a Jeep tire covers buying guide with all the information you need to make an informed decision.
First and foremost, your tire cover needs to function as intended. It should protect your tire from the elements, such as rain, snow, and UV rays. A good tire cover will also prevent rocks, dirt, and other debris from getting stuck in the tread of your tire. When selecting a tire cover, make sure it is made of durable, weather-resistant material that can withstand the elements.
The material of your tire cover not only impacts the functionality but also affects its aesthetics. The most popular materials for tire covers are vinyl, polyester, and canvas. Vinyl covers are lightweight, easy to clean, and inexpensive. However, they are not as durable as polyester or canvas and may crack or fade over time. Polyester covers are more UV resistant than vinyl, but they are not as thick or sturdy as canvas covers. Canvas covers are the most durable and can withstand exposure to the sun, rain, and snow over extended periods. However, they are usually more expensive than the other two materials.
The size of your tire cover is the most critical factor to consider. The cover needs to be the right size to fit your Jeep's specific tire. When buying a tire cover, you need to know the right size for your tire. Tire covers come in various sizes, so you must measure your tire's diameter and select the correct cover size. Ordering a tire cover that is too big or too small will not serve the intended purpose and may even damage your tire.

Weather resistance is an essential factor to take into consideration when purchasing a Jeep tire cover. The cover needs to be able to withstand different weather conditions, such as rain, snow, hail, sun rays, and dust. Materials like thick canvas or polyester with a water-resistant coating are ideal for the cover to serve its function. The weather resistance of the cover will determine how long it will last and protect the tire. Consider a cover that can hold up to any weather and still maintain its quality.
The quality of construction of the tire cover is critical for protection and durability. Consider a cover with strong seams, zippers, and stitching. A poorly constructed cover may rip, tear or come off the tire and not serve its purpose effectively. A well-constructed cover that holds tightly to the tire can also prevent anything from finding its way inside the tire or eroding the rubber. You can check the reviews of others who have purchased the cover to verify its quality.
You want to purchase a tire cover that is easy to install and remove. A cover that is easy to set up will save you time, and you can enjoy your Jeep without wasting precious time. Most tire covers come with user manuals, clips, hooks or snaps that are easy to use. Spend some time researching for brands with a simple installation process to make the process easy for you.
If you have any spare tire accessories like an Off-Road jack, bumper or backup camera, make sure the tire cover you choose is compatible with them. The accessories should not interfere with the tire cover's function or cause difficulty in installation or removal. You can also consider purchasing a tire cover from the same manufacturer as your spare tire accessories to ensure compatibility.
